About the role
Responsibilities
- Lead and develop an engineering team responsible for Avionics or AP&S Modifications execution, establishing priorities and accountability for technical delivery.
- Provide people leadership and coaching by mentoring engineers and supporting career development.
- Drive project execution in partnership with Program Management to establish integrated plans, resource strategies, and schedules.
- Oversee technical risk, issue, and opportunity management to ensure early identification and sound mitigation plans.
- Guide the resolution of complex cross-functional technical challenges and facilitate Technical Design Reviews (TDRs).
- Ensure certification and compliance by engaging with FAA and EASA-appointed personnel and reinforcing regulatory adherence.
- Support proposal activities by evaluating Statements of Work and defining required engineering effort and cost estimates.
- Promote a culture of safety, quality, and accountability through disciplined engineering practices.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ree or higher in engineering, computer science, mathematics, physics, or chemistry.
- At least one year of experience in a leadership role (team leader, manager, or large-scale project management).
- 3+ years of experience working with FAA and EASA regulations and requirements.
- 5+ years of experience communicating complex technical risks and advising senior leaders.
- Experience reviewing IPC, SB, or AD, or experience with certification processes such as ATC, STC, or MTC.
- Ability to travel up to 10% domestically and internationally.
Preferred Qualifications
- 5+ years of experience leading multi-disciplined, complex engineering projects and teams.
- Knowledge of Boeing's organizational processes, program plans, and products.
- Experience working directly with regulators such as the FAA or a delegated ODA Office.
- Experience training or mentoring in a technical environment.
- Experience presenting to executive-level leadership.
